What Are the Key Factors That Influence Stihl Chainsaw Prices?
The key factors that influence Stihl chainsaw prices include:
- Model and Specifications: Different models of Stihl chainsaws come with varying specifications that affect their price. Higher-end models with advanced features such as more powerful engines, longer bars, and specialized cutting capabilities will generally command higher prices due to their enhanced performance and durability.
- Market Demand: The demand for specific chainsaw models can significantly impact pricing. During peak seasons, such as spring and fall when tree maintenance is common, prices may rise due to increased demand, while off-season purchasing might lead to discounts and better pricing options.
- Retailer Pricing Strategies: Retailers may have different pricing strategies based on their inventory, competition, and sales goals. Some may offer promotions or bundle deals that can lower the overall cost, while others might price higher based on brand positioning or service offerings, such as extended warranties and maintenance plans.
- Location and Shipping Costs: The cost of Stihl chainsaws can vary by location due to shipping costs and local market conditions. Chainsaws sold in rural areas may have higher prices due to transportation costs, while urban retailers might offer more competitive pricing due to higher competition.
- Seasonal Sales and Promotions: Stihl and its authorized dealers often have seasonal sales, clearance events, or holiday promotions that can significantly affect prices. Keeping an eye on these events can lead to finding the best prices on Stihl chainsaws throughout the year.

Which Stihl Chainsaw Models Offer the Best Prices for Quality?
The following Stihl chainsaw models are known for offering the best prices while maintaining quality performance:
- Stihl MS 170: This model is an excellent choice for homeowners looking for a lightweight and affordable chainsaw.
- Stihl MS 250: Known for its balance of power and price, this chainsaw is ideal for both cutting firewood and light tree work.
- Stihl MS 271: This chainsaw offers a great combination of performance and value, making it suitable for more demanding tasks.
- Stihl MS 362: A professional-grade model that delivers high performance at a competitive price, ideal for landowners and contractors.
The Stihl MS 170 is one of the most affordable models, making it perfect for casual users. It features a lightweight design, making it easy to handle, and is ideal for trimming small branches and cutting firewood, proving that you don’t need to spend a lot to get a reliable tool.
The Stihl MS 250 strikes a good balance between power and cost, providing a robust option for users who need a chainsaw for various tasks around the yard. With a 45.4 cc engine, it delivers ample power for cutting logs and pruning trees while still being light enough for less strenuous jobs.
The Stihl MS 271 is a step up in terms of performance, equipped with a powerful engine and advanced features that enhance efficiency and reduce emissions. Its price point remains competitive, making it a favorite among users who require a dependable saw for both home use and occasional professional work.
For those seeking a more professional-grade option, the Stihl MS 362 offers exceptional performance without breaking the bank. With its high power-to-weight ratio and advanced technology such as the M-Tronic engine management system, this chainsaw is designed for heavy-duty tasks, making it a worthy investment for serious users.

When Is the Ideal Time to Buy a Stihl Chainsaw for the Best Price?
The ideal times to buy a Stihl chainsaw for the best price include seasonal sales, holiday promotions, and end-of-year clearance events.
- Spring Sales: Many retailers offer discounts on outdoor equipment in the spring as homeowners prepare for yard work and landscaping. This is a prime time to find chainsaws at reduced prices, especially at the beginning of the season when inventory turnover is high.
- Holiday Promotions: Major holidays such as Memorial Day, Labor Day, and Black Friday often feature sales on tools and outdoor equipment. Retailers may provide significant discounts during these events as they compete for customers, making it an excellent opportunity to purchase a Stihl chainsaw at a lower price.
- End-of-Season Clearance: As summer comes to a close, many stores look to clear out inventory to make room for winter products. This often results in markdowns on chainsaws and other gardening tools, allowing buyers to snag deals at the end of the season.
- Local Deals and Discounts: Check local dealerships or hardware stores for special promotions and discounts that may not be advertised online. Sometimes, local retailers offer exclusive deals or bundle offers that can significantly reduce the price of a Stihl chainsaw.
- Online Retailer Promotions: Websites like Amazon or specialized tool retailers frequently have sales, especially during events like Cyber Monday or during their own promotional periods. Subscribing to newsletters or following these retailers on social media can alert you to flash sales or exclusive online discounts.

What Are the Risks and Benefits of Purchasing Used Chainsaws?
When considering purchasing used chainsaws, there are several risks and benefits to evaluate.
- Cost Savings: Buying a used chainsaw typically offers significant savings compared to new models, allowing you to acquire a quality tool at a fraction of the price.
- Availability of High-Quality Brands: Purchasing used chainsaws can provide access to higher-end brands, like Stihl, that may otherwise be out of your budget when new.
- Potential for Hidden Issues: Used chainsaws may have wear and tear that isn’t immediately visible, leading to unexpected repair costs or safety concerns.
- Limited Warranty or No Warranty: Most used chainsaws come without a warranty, meaning any repairs or replacements will be at your own expense.
- Environmental Impact: Buying used tools contributes to reducing waste and promotes sustainability by extending the life of existing equipment.
- Opportunity for Testing: In some cases, buying used allows you to test the chainsaw before purchasing, ensuring it meets your needs and functions properly.
Cost savings are one of the most compelling reasons to purchase a used chainsaw, as they can be found at significantly lower prices than new models, making them accessible for budget-conscious buyers.
Additionally, opting for a used chainsaw can allow you to purchase high-quality brands like Stihl, which may be priced beyond reach if bought new, thus enhancing your toolset without overspending.
However, potential buyers must beware of hidden issues such as dull chains, worn-out parts, or mechanical failures that may not be immediately apparent, which could lead to costly repairs or safety hazards.
Moreover, many used chainsaws do not come with a warranty, leaving the buyer responsible for any future issues or replacements, which is a risk that needs serious consideration.
From an environmental perspective, purchasing used equipment is a sustainable choice, as it helps reduce waste and minimizes the demand for new manufacturing.
Lastly, some sellers may allow you to test the used chainsaw before buying, which can be beneficial in ensuring the tool fits your requirements and functions effectively.
